18&U Boys County Cup 2026

20th-22nd March, Group 4a at Edgbaston Priory

 

Team: Charlie Harvey, Mohan Mehta, Harry Cornhill, Oliver Westbrook, Nicholas Morrell, Oliver Osborne, Harry Cartledge and Ethan Dallas.

Captains: Seb Callcut and Fin Barrett

 

The 18&U boys team travelled to Edgbaston Priory, a fantastic venue for division 4 of this year’s county cup event. The team consisted of Charlie, Mohan, Harry Cornhill, Oliver W, Nicholas, Oliver O, Harry Cartledge and Ethan. The boys were the favourites to be promoted from their group, with strong rankings and great strength in depth.  Captain Seb Callcut reminded the boys it is not always easy being the hunted rather than the hunters.

 Day 1 saw them take on Derbyshire, with 3 courts available for Oliver O, Nicholas and Oliver W to start us off. Both Ollies raced through their first sets 6-0, before getting the first points on the board. Nicholas Morrell opponent had an ITF ranking higher than his LTA ranking, but after losing the first set 6-2, he rallied to take the next two sets 6-0 and 6-2. Bucks went up 3-0, with our top 3 singles players Charlie, Mohan and Harry Co ready to go. All were focused and picked up wins in straight sets Charlie 6-2 6-2, Mohan 6-4 6-1 and Harry Cornhill 6-4 6-1. A great effort to win the match before the doubles, laying down a marker for the rest of the weekend. With the potential for rubbers won being a factor at the end of the weekend, the team didn’t let up. Ethan and Harry Cartledge came in for their first matches of the weekend and we picked up three fairly comfortable wins. Harry Cornhill and Nicholas won 6-3 6-2 at 1st pair, Ethan and Charlie won 6-0 6-2 at 2nd pair and Harry Cartledge and Mohan sealed a 9-0 victory with their 6-4 6-4 win.

Day 2 saw us take on Staffordshire, who had lost the day before. We stuck with the same singles line up, Oliver O wasted no time in winning 6-0 6-0 and Nicholas followed very soon after 6-0 6-1. Three nil up again at the halfway stage in the singles, as Oliver W had another good performance winning 6-3 6-2. Harry Cornhill kept the scoreboard ticking over with a 6-0 6-1 win putting the boys 4-0 up. Mohan and Charlie had closer matches against strong opponents, but both were very focused with Mohan winning 6-4 6-2 and Charlie 6-4 6-4. So the team had the match won again after the singles. 2 out of 3 in the doubles meant a great 8-1 win on day 2.

Day 3 was the promotion battle against Wiltshire, who had won the previous two days, so both teams were feeling confident. We had to change the singles line up with Harry Cornhill nursing a slight arm injury, so that bought Harry Cartledge in at 6 pushing those above up a place. Nicholas got us off to the perfect start with a 6-1 6-4 win, followed by Harry Cartledge (who only knew he was playing the singles 10 minutes before the match started) with a solid 6-4 6-1 win.  Oliver O playing a very good opponent with a first set that lasted 1 hour 30 mins finally clinching it 7-5 and he then went from strength to strength winning 7-5 6-1. So Bucks went 3-0 up. Oliver W, who is still in his first year at 16&U, put in a good performance against an opponent who was not missing, losing 3-6 2-6. Mohan at 2 played his best tennis of the weekend with some massive serving and forehands to take out a very good opponent 6-3 6-1.  Bucks were 4-1 up needing one more win to seal promotion.

The race for that promotion moment was on, Charlie was playing at 1 against a similarly-ranked player, while the others were given 45 minutes to rest before the start of the doubles. The 3rd pair of Harry Cartledge and Nicholas, started at the same time as 2nd pair Harry Cornhill and Mohan. Meanwhile Charlie was part of the highest quality match of the weekend. They were on court for 2 hours 39 minutes and by the time he finished we were a set up in each of the doubles. But it was fitting that Charlie in his final match for the Bucks 18&U team would win us promotion with a massive 7-5 7-6 (10-8) battling win. Both doubles rubbers were also won, giving us a 7-1 win and a deserved promotion to Division 3 in 2027!
